A George V silver cased teaspoon set, Lee & Wigfull, Sheffield, 1910-1912
comprising: six teaspoons, a pair of sugar nips, a butter knife and a dish with clear-glass liner, each engraved with the initials 'A.J',the case with some distress,210g of weighable silver
